David receives a phone call from Carmen Walters, magazine editor on Silhouette magazine.  Barbara takes the phone from David and speaks to Carmen Walters.  She asks David when his next evening off is and David tells Barbara that he doesn't have to be here.  Barbara tells Carmen Walters that she will phone her back.  Barbara tells David that the least she can do is give Carmen Walters dinner.  She says it will be good publicity for her book.  "Leave me out of it," says David and walks out of the room.
 
Ron Brownlow tells Iris Scott that Kevin Banks is thinking of expanding his business, and Iris says Kevin will go far.  Ron tells Iris that Glenda can't have children and she is very upset.  Iris tells Ron that she has never been close to anyone.  Ron takes her hand and says he never wants to hear her say she hasn't got anyone.  He kisses her.  "Never again," says Ron.
 
Barbara Hunter goes into the office and finds Adam Chance working late.  She asks him if it would be alright if she tooka couple of photocopies.  Barbara asks Adam how things are at the moment with David and Adam says he keeps them all on their toes.  He says David is right though, this business could grow.  Barbara tells Adam that she has been offered a feature for Silhouette magazine but David isn't keen on the idea.
 
Ron Brownlow tells Iris Scott that he is going to take her out to dinner at the motel.  Iris tells him that she doesn't want to go there, but Ron says he wants all this out in the open, he wants to show everyone that they are friends.
 
Barbara Hunter asks Adam Chance if Wednesday would be alright for him and Meg to come to dinner at the Coach House because it's Davids night off.  Adam tells her that Mrg is on reception duty that night but he will phone Jill and ask her if she can cover for Meg.
 
Mavis Hooper joins Ron Brownlow and Iris Scott in Iris's flat.  Ron asks Mavis if she has eaten and would she like to join them for a meal out. 
 
Helli is on duty at the reception desk when Gilbert Latham comes into the motel.  He asks her if it would be possible to speak to David Hunter.  Helli tells Gilbert Latham that Mr Hunter has gone home but Mr Chance is still in the office.  Gilbert tells Helli that he doesn't really want to see Mr Chance.
 
Gilbert Latham goes into the motel office and tells Adam Chance that he has come about the calendar for the motel.  He says he saw Mr Hunter about it.  Adam Chance tells Gilbert Latham that David Hunter is very interested in the calendar and wrote to him telling him to go ahead.  Adam takes out the letter from the files and gives it to Gilbert Latham to read.  Gilbert Latham says the terms and fees mentioned are very generous and Adam tells him that they don't want this calendar to be just a series of boring photos.  He says they have several beautiful girls working for them and he wants them featured prominantly.
 
Ron Brownlow, Iris Scott and Mavis Hooper arrive at the motel, and Ron books a table for three.  Adam Chance comes into the reception and stops to have a few words with Ron Brownlow.  Glenda Banks, who is working that evening, comes into reception and stares at Ron and Iris Scott.  Adam Chance asks Ron Brownlow if he is ready to order and Ron says yes.  Adam Chance calls Glenda over and asks her to take the order.  Glenda goes to their table and gives Iris Scott an icy stare.  Iris stares back at her and gives her order.
 
Gilbert Latham talks to Helli in reception and she asks him if he thinks of himself as a good photographer.  Gilbert Latham tells Helli that he won a competition.  helli asks him if he would like her to model for him as she has done a bit of photographic modelling before. 
 
Glenda Banks goes home after work in an angry mood and asks Ron why he had to bring Iris Scott to the motel.  Ron says he forgot it was her night on duty.  "Anyway you are talking about someone I love," says Ron.  Glenda says he can't mean that.  Ron tells Glenda that she feels about Iris how she feels about Kevin.  He says he is going to be seen with Iris and maybe they will bump into her.  Glenda says she isn't thinking about herself, but what are their parents going to say.  "It'll be a nice home-coming for them won't it," says Glenda.
 
Kevin tells Glenda that he has made an appointment to see the bank manager about a loan.  Glenda asks how much he would have to borrow and Kevin says £10,000.
 
David Hunter is alone at the Coach House when he receives a visit from Carmen Walters.  She apologises for being early.  David invites her in and tells her that Barbara is in Birmingham.  He offers Carmen Walters a drink.  Carmen Walters asks David if he reads his wife's books and David says yes.  "Our photographers going to love you," says Carmen Walters, looking admiringly at David.  "You and Barbara must make a lovely couple," she adds.  They hear a car pull up outside the house.  "Really you were a smashing interviewee," says Carmen Walters  "I didn't know I was being interviewd," says David. 
 
Barbara Hunter comes into the Coach House and greets Carmen Walters.  Carmen tells Barbara that she arrived early but David has been charming company.  Carmen Walters asks David how long they were in Algiers and says she knows about Davids' son's activities.  She asks Barbara how she gets on with Chris Hunter and Barbara says very well, they are all good friends.  Carmen Walters asks David and Barbara how long they have been together.  "Two years," says David.  "No, I mean how long have you been together in all," says Carmen.  "We didn't live together before our marriage if that's what you mean," says David.
 
Carmen says she heard that his first wife was here for the engagement party and David says that's private and he doesn't want to discuss it.  David tells Carmen Walters that he must ask her not to use any personal information.  Carmen says this interview is supposed to be about the private life of Barbara Brady, besides he will have to get used to it.  "Being married to a celebrity is almost like being a celebrity yourself," says Carmen Walters.  David says there are legal restraints.  Carmen tells him that she isn't going to write anything libelous in her article, she has that all checked before the article is published.  She reminds David that she was invited into his house.  "And now I must ask you to leave," says David.  David goes towards the other room.  "Will you please let me know when she has gone," he says and walks out of the room.
 
Diane Hunter and Miranda Pollard dress in outfits for each month of the calendar.  Gilbert Latham tells them that it isn't going to be that sort of calendar.
 
Barbara Hunter shows Carmen Walters out and apologises to her for David's behaviour.  "I don't suppose you'll be needing the photographs," says Barbara.  Carmen says yes, she will send the phtographer around.  "I do understand.  He's very dishy," says Carmen Walters, and leaves. 
 
Barbara Hunter sits down on the settee and David comes into the room and sits down opposite her.  "That's another fine mess I've got you into," says David.  Barbara tells him it's not important.  "The woman's a shark," says Barbara.  She asks David what he and Carmen Walters talked about before she arrived, because he looked as white as a sheet when she arrived.  David tells her that he didn't know he was being interviewed, he thought he was just keeping the woman company.  Barbara says it's her fault, she shouldn't have dragged him into her work.  Barbara tells David that there is one thing she would like him to do, pose for the photographs.  She says if they gaze at each other lovingly then Carmen will have to write a good article to go with the photos.
